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
Practical Metal Polishing - Nearly always, metal polishing is necessary for appearance and clean-room usage. It's one of the more common treatments for its use in intensifying the original attractiveness of the items, for instance, motorcycle parts, car parts or kitchenware. In addition, a great many clean-rooms require a lustrous finish so as to lessen the perviousness of the material which can cause debris to gather and contaminate. A superb illustration of this use could be in a vacuum chamber. You will find a number of methods of finish metal, and we'll check out several of the steps required. Metal may be burnished by hand, using purpose built buffing machines, electromechanically or chemically. A finishing compound or paste could be utilized, that might incorporate chromium oxide, tripoli,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, limestone, or iron oxide. Buffing stainless steel, due to its weak thermal conductivity, fairly high viscidness, and hardness is considered the most time intensive. More over, things made of non-ferrous metals are certainly more responsive to polishing, because they need the minimum amount of operations.
If a high processing quality will not be required, faster pad speeds should be employed. A slower pad speed is required if a high standard mirror finish is obligatory. Polishing buffs covered in compound can be very much affected by the forces on the pad. The level of the surface pressure could be accelerated within certain restrictions, though going above the correct level of force not simply cuts down on the quality level of treatment, but also can worsen performance, might result in wear to the component, and also an apparent heating of the objects being worked on, as a consequence of friction. When working thin pieces, it is higher temperature (and a relating bendability of the metal) that will oftentimes cause materials to distort, warp or buckle. Basically, it requires a practiced technician to take into account all these points to equally avoid harm to the workpiece and to perform the job proficiently. To be able to significantly boost the quality of the resultant finish, the polishing operation should really be carried out with not as much power and not as much force so that you can in the end complete a surface area devoid of scores or marks left behind by the finishing procedure, thereby arriving at a sparkling mirror finish.
